January 20, 2007: Phil Morris - Martian Manhunter - Interview

KryptonSite caught up with Phil Morris, the actor playing the Martian Manhunter on "Smallville" in season 6. Here's a part of that interview...

    Q: Is it true that you are a big comic book fan?

    A: I am a huge comic book fan. I have 20,000 issues, actually. I've been collecting since I was seven years old, and I have some really original stuff. So, to do Smallville, for me, is more than an honor; it's almost like a rite of passage.

    Q: Had you always been a fan of the Martian Manhunter?

    A: I'm a fan of all the DC Universe characters, and Martian Manhunter, to me - it's weird to say this - but he's one of the most humane of all the DC Universe characters. Odd that he's from Mars, but he has such a great sense of compassion, such a great sense of humanity. So yeah, I'm a big fan of Martian Manhunter. And I'm a big fan of Carl Lumbly, who voices the Martian Manhunter on the Justice League for Warner Brothers.

    Q: You've done voice work on the Justice League animated series as well, is that correct?

    A: I play Vandal Savage for them, and I just voiced the new straight-to-video DVD of the Darwyn Cooke graphic novel The New Frontier. So it's great. It's funny, because I did that the week before I went up to Vancouver to do Smallville; so I'm playing opposite [the Martian Manhunter] in the cartoon, and then I am actually him in Smallville. It's very wild.
